Infraestrutura e Redes

Docker Swarm

Orquestração de Containers

O Docker Swarm é uma ferramenta nativa de orquestração para containers Docker. Ele agrupa vários servidores (VPS) para operarem como uma unidade coordenada. Diferente de sistemas em servidor único, o Swarm distribui o trabalho entre várias máquinas. Ele cria condições para a disponibilidade das aplicações ao reiniciar serviços falhos automaticamente em servidores saudáveis.

Papel na operação

Onde o Docker Swarm entra

O Docker Swarm é uma ferramenta nativa de orquestração para containers Docker. Ele agrupa vários servidores (VPS) para operarem como uma unidade coordenada. Diferente de sistemas em servidor único, o Swarm distribui o trabalho entre várias máquinas. Ele cria condições para a disponibilidade das aplicações ao reiniciar serviços falhos automaticamente em servidores saudáveis. Dentro da nossa stack, Docker Swarm cobre a frente de proteger serviços, manter uptime e dar previsibilidade técnica para toda a stack.

Recomendação Promovaweb

Recomendamos o Docker Swarm como o orquestrador padrão para a infraestrutura de nossos alunos e projetos. Priorizamos a simplicidade operacional em vez da complexidade do Kubernetes (K8s) para Pequenas e Médias Empresas (PMEs) e Agências. Enquanto o Kubernetes exige equipes dedicadas, o Docker Swarm é nativo, simplifica a configuração e oferece Alta Disponibilidade (High Availability).

Nativo e Leve

Já vem embutido no Docker Engine (Community Edition). Isso reduz a necessidade de instalar orquestradores externos pesados ou gerenciar clusters complexos de terceiros.

Alta Disponibilidade (Self-Healing)

Realiza o monitoramento constante da saúde dos containers. Se uma instância falha ou um servidor cai, o Swarm redistribui a carga e reinicia os serviços automaticamente.

Segurança com Docker Secrets

Oferece gerenciamento profissional de senhas, chaves de API e certificados. Os dados são armazenados de forma criptografada e injetados apenas na memória dos containers autorizados.

Onde gera valor real

Docker Swarm gera valor quando deixa de ser um nome solto na stack e passa a sustentar um pedaço claro da operação. É assim que a ferramenta reduz retrabalho, melhora leitura de gargalos e cria uma rotina mais confiável para times enxutos.

Critério de recomendação Promovaweb

Recomendamos o Docker Swarm como o orquestrador padrão para a infraestrutura de nossos alunos e projetos. Priorizamos a simplicidade operacional em vez da complexidade do Kubernetes (K8s) para Pequenas e Médias Empresas (PMEs) e Agências. Enquanto o Kubernetes exige equipes dedicadas, o Docker Swarm é nativo, simplifica a configuração e oferece Alta Disponibilidade (High Availability). O critério da Promovaweb considera transparência tecnológica, menor dependência de fornecedor e autonomia para evoluir a stack no próprio ritmo, por isso a recomendação não nasce de moda nem de promessa genérica. Ela nasce do impacto real da ferramenta sobre custo recorrente, clareza operacional e capacidade de crescimento.

Repositório verificado

GitHub oficial

Quando a ferramenta tem um repositório oficial ou diretamente associado ao produto, ele entra aqui para ajudar na leitura de atividade, licença e manutenção.

Repositório do SwarmKit, base do modo Swarm. Verificado em 21 de mai. de 2026.

github.com

moby/swarmkit

Ver repo

A toolkit for orchestrating distributed systems at any scale. It includes primitives for node discovery, raft-based consensus, task scheduling and more.

3,6 mil Estrelas
656 Forks
Linguagem Go
Licença Apache-2.0
Atualizado 23 de abr. de 2026

Visão geral

Leituras complementares sobre o Docker Swarm

Rede Overlay Criptografada

Cria túneis de comunicação seguros e isolados entre servidores diferentes. Isso permite que ferramentas como n8n e bancos de dados conversem de forma privada.

Atualizações Graduais (Rolling Updates)

Permite a atualização de software de forma controlada. O sistema mantém a disponibilidade durante a manutenção ou implementação de novas funcionalidades.

Curva de Aprendizado Pragmática

Oferece os principais benefícios operacionais de orquestração com baixa complexidade de gestão. Isso permite que agências e Founders dominem sua própria infraestrutura com rapidez.

Docker Swarm ainda é uma opção viável frente ao Kubernetes?

Sim. O Swarm é mantido pela Docker Inc. e é a escolha ideal para agências que buscam eficiência e simplicidade sem os custos operacionais do Kubernetes.

Posso rodar o Docker Swarm em apenas um servidor (VPS)?

Sim. O uso em nó único oferece vantagens como gestão de segredos, configurações nativas e atualizações graduais, facilitando a expansão futura.

O que são "Managers" e "Workers" no Swarm?

Managers coordenam o cluster e decidem onde os serviços serão executados. Workers são os nós responsáveis por rodar os containers. Em ambientes menores, um único servidor pode desempenhar ambas as funções.

Entenda o Docker Swarm. Depois opere com critério.

A página mostra o papel do Docker Swarm na stack. A Formação Martech mostra como transformar isso em rotina, entrega e operação mais estável.